I am a Mental Health Counselor licensed in New York State. Through my experiences during my master's degree program, 1,200 hrs of internship, over 3,000 hrs of supervised counseling for licensure, I have dealt with many issues in a wide variety of clients. Anxiety, depression, relationship and sexual issues, anger management, motivational issues, etc. I have experience working with individuals, couples, and families of all ages and backgrounds.

As a counselor I always give the benefit of the doubt. I assume that making the choice to engage with a counselor means that clients are ready to do the work. This means that they will do the homework that is assigned and make a concerted effort to help themselves. My approach is varied because I believe that it is the counselor's responsibility to find a therapy that best fits the client rather than try and fit a client to a specific therapy. I most often use cognitive behavioral techniques, rational-emotive behavioral techniques, client-centered (Rogerian), dialectical behavior therapy, and Gestalt techniques in my counseling.

I believe that we are in this together, working to empower you to make the desired changes. This process is not always easy, but discomfort equals growth. I look forward to working with you!

Online counseling, sometimes called teletherapy, refers to talk therapy delivered remotely through digital platforms, such as video calls, phone calls, or chat. It can be a great option for people who face barriers to traditional face-to-face therapy, such as those living in remote areas, individuals with mobility issues, or people with busy schedules that make it difficult to attend in-person sessions. Teletherapy also offers greater convenience and flexibility, allowing clients to access care from the comfort of their homes. Research shows that the treatment outcomes with online counseling are often just as effective as with traditional therapy, providing a viable alternative for individuals seeking mental health support.
